Complete Ingredient Transparency (key actives + full INCI)
- Key actives explained: [cite_start]
- • Green Tea Extract (70%): A powerful antioxidant that provides a cooling sensation to soothe redness, blemishes, and sunburns[cite: 1943, 1946]. [cite_start]
- • D-Panthenol (5,000ppm): Also known as Pro-Vitamin B5, it has moisturizing, regenerating, and anti-inflammatory effects[cite: 1943, 1946]. [cite_start]It is the key ingredient in the Hydrium line. [cite: 1943, 1946] [cite_start]
- • Allantoin: An ingredient known for its soothing and moisturizing properties that helps to smooth the skin[cite: 1943, 1946]. [cite_start]
- • Aloe Vera Leaf Extract: Provides a cooling and soothing sensation[cite: 1943, 1946]. [cite_start]
- Full INCI (exact order): Water, Propanediol, Camellia Sinensis Leaf Extract, Glycerin, Pentylene Glycol, 1,2-Hexanediol, Acrylates/C10-30 Alkyl Acrylate Crosspolymer, Panthenol, Tromethamine, Butylene Glycol, Cetearyl Olivate, Sorbitan Olivate, Allantoin, Aloe Ferox Leaf Extract, Ethylhexylglycerin, Glyceryl Acrylate/Acrylic Acid Copolymer. About the Brand: COSRX (their philosophy)
COSRX is a well-known Korean brand that focuses on developing functional skincare with simple yet effective formulations. The brand name itself is a portmanteau of "Cosmetics" and "Rx" (prescription), reflecting their dermatological approach to skincare problems. Their philosophy is to create products that are "simple, but enough".
Glossary (key terms explained)
- D-Panthenol: Pro-Vitamin B5 that moisturizes, soothes, and helps to repair the skin barrier.
- Allantoin: An ingredient that promotes cell proliferation, aiding in the healing and soothing of irritated skin.
- Green Tea Extract: A powerful antioxidant that can calm redness and inflammation.
- MFDS: The Korean Ministry of Food and Drug Safety, which regulates cosmetic and pharmaceutical products in South Korea.
